Perfect Square
1829541730548538422032036571325396338884149248036 is a perfect square (1352605533978232111104006 × 1352605533978232111104006)
1829541730548538422032036571325396338884149248036 is a perfect square (1352605533978232111104006 × 1352605533978232111104006)
1829541730548538422032036571325396338884149248036 is even
Previous even number is 1829541730548538422032036571325396338884149248034
Next even number is 1829541730548538422032036571325396338884149248038
6123884057165546273699172074495645836115169093824124097262927152514404691859164630177949555550530515249804898334238570344954182024930838708270656
3347222943818540767532819008697264686118818424074429230153795072061811949006456077138624249857296
10100000001110111011111010001001000100010001100110110001001101111100111100001010111001111000011101001000110001110000101011111100110110101001110000000000000100100